serial: 8250_ingenic: Enable hardware flow control



The Ingenic UART is similar to a standard 16550, but hardware flow control
requires setting a couple of additional, non-standard bits in the MCR.

The non-standard "modem control enable" and "hardware flow control
mode" bits are set when writing to the MCR register, based
on whether the modem control interrupt is active.

Additionally the non-16550 compliant parts of the uart need to be
masked from higher layers.

Tested on Ingenic JZ4780 on MIPS Creator Ci20 board
